What are the functions of the explorer?
To detect the texture and character of tooth surfaces before, during and after calculus removal, to detect carious lesions and to evaluate dental anomalies and anatomic features.

What are some side effects of Chlorhexidine?
Temporary loss of taste, discoloring of teeth and tongue, an increase of supraginigival calculus formation.

Name at least two ways to stop the fogging of the reflecting surface.
-warm the reflecting surface against the patient’s buccal mucosa
-ask patient to breathe through their nose
-wipe the reflecting surface with a commercial defogging solution
-wipe the reflecting surface with a gauze square moistened with mouthwash

What are the explorer design characteristics?
-It is flexible at the working-end
-the working-end may be paired or unpaired
-the working-end is 1 to 2 mm in length
-it is circular when cross- sectioned
